Color Discrepancy Issue Between Photoshop and After Effects

Hi everyone,

I’m working on VFX for a short film and have run into a color discrepancy issue that I hope someone might be able to help with.

Project Details:

  • Footage: The video was shot on a Sony Alpha SIII in S-Gamut3.Cine/S-Log3.
  • Objective: I need to add 2D elements to the background of one shot using Photoshop’s generative AI.
  • Process:
    • After Effect working color Space is Rec. 709 Gamma 2.4
      Tobias28052803rven_1-1721572867762.png

       

    • Export: I export a frame from After Effects with a Rec. 709 LUT applied via Composition - Save Frame As Photoshop Layers.
    • Photoshop: I add background elements to the exported frame. Photoshop's working color space is set to Rec. 709 Gamma 2.4. Tobias28052803rven_4-1721572955056.png

       

    • Reimport: After editing, I reimport the Photoshop file back into After Effects.

Issue:

When I import the Photoshop file into After Effects the colors of the photoshop layer match perfectly with the video footage (Rec.709 Lut applied).

However, when I apply the Profile Converter effect to the photoshop layer (Input: Rec. 709 Gamma 2.4, Output: S-Gamut3.Cine/S-Log3) and switch of the LUT on the video layer, the colors don’t match the original video footage. Specifically, the Photoshop layer appears slightly darker compared to the video footage

Tobias28052803rven_5-1721573364143.pngTobias28052803rven_6-1721573457229.pngTobias28052803rven_7-1721573506015.png

 

Troubleshooting Steps Taken:

  1. Verified Color Profiles and Settings:

    • Ensured that the Photoshop file is correctly converted to Rec. 709 Gamma 2.4.
    • Checked that After Effects color management settings match Rec. 709 Gamma 2.4.
  2. Profile Converter Effect:

    • Double-checked the settings for the Profile Converter effect.
    •  
  3. Other Effects and Layers:

    • Verified there are no additional effects affecting the appearance.
  4. Software Updates:

    • Confirmed that both Photoshop and After Effects are updated to their latest versions.

Request:

Does anyone have any suggestions on how to resolve this discrepancy? I’m looking for advice on ensuring that my Photoshop edits match the original video footage when reimported into After Effects.
